Mr.Shyam Kumar Singh 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E BIRENDRA KUMAR ORAL ORDER 01-07-2019 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ned APP for the State.

Petitioner seeks bail in a case registered for the offences punishable under Sections 302, 201/34 of the Indian Penal Code.

The F.I.R. of the occurrence of murder is against unknown, recorded on the Fardbeyan of local Dafadar on recovery of dead body laying in a well.

Submission is that name of the petitioner surfaced in the confessional statement of co-accused. There is no witness of the occurrence. Petitioner is in custody since 30.01.2019. Investigation of the case is already complete. Considering the facts aforesaid, let the petitioner, above named, be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of
